Re: Retirement of the Stonebriar product line

Stonebriar sales have declined for five consecutive quarters and support costs now exceed contribution margin. The retirement plan is staged: new orders close end of Q2, existing contracts honoured through their terms, and spares stocked for twenty-four months. Sales leads should steer prospects toward the Ashgrove range; migration incentives are already approved. Customer comms are drafted and awaiting legal sign-off. The forward strategy behind this decision is set out in the note below.

confidential, yafog-hagug: Gross margin on Druix came in at 10 percent against a plan of 15 percent. Only 5 of the 80 pilot accounts renewed Druix, so a churn review is set for October 1.

## Sensor drift: what to do at 3am

If the GrowLoop controller starts reporting humidity swings that don't match the backup probes in the Fernwick greenhouse, it's almost always sensor drift, not an actual climate event. Don't panic and don't touch the vents manually. First, restart the calibration daemon and give it ten minutes to re-baseline. If readings still disagree by more than 5%, flip the controller into safe mode. The safe-mode thresholds it will use are these.

config for yahap-bajof:
[istix]
host = istix.qorvelsys.internal
user = istix_svc
database = istix_prod

Hey team — handing off the waveform preview feature in Soundloft before I rotate to the Kestrel project. Quick notes for support: previews are generated async, so a blank waveform usually just means the render job is still queued. If it's stuck more than five minutes, restart the `waveforge` worker. Zoom glitches on long files are a known issue; ticket's already filed. The worker runs with this configuration.

service settings:
[casax]
port = 6379
team = rusir
host = casax.zemvarhq.corp
region = outer-4
access_code = ac_9808ce
timeout_ms = 1500